Download treeview control vb6 shell

The listview looks similar to the treeview control in that items can be grouped note that items need to be added when a listitem is expanded and removed when contracted by the programmer. Creating an explorer style interface with the listview and treeview. Enabling shell styles for the listview and treeview controls. Vb migration partner knowledge base minor differences. Net project help lets start our discussion with a few simple properties that you can see that design time through the controls property pages. Load a treeview from a text file with tabs denoting indentation in vb. Drop it onto your form, and the existing vb menus become ownerdrawn. This is a simple treeview derived control that mimics the windows explorer interface. The foldertreeview ftv control is not a standard treeview control, but one that provides. Explorer treeview control with shell folder access class and icon management. If not then how can i reduce the no of clicks for the user. Here is an example of the nodecheck, collapse, and expand events. Netsqldataadapter, oracle, page, root oracle data nodes, and sqlconnection.

So simply stated i want a multiselect option in vb6 control. Each treenode in the treeview represents a file or folder in the file system. Mbtreeviewexplorer is an explorer which inherits all the properties of simple treeview control. A treeview is made up of nodes that are related to each other in some way. Everything is free and comes with full source code. Application crashes when displaying a microsoft treeview control on a touchscreen device. How can i map the drives and display them in a vb6 treeview control. This module integrates the yui treeview into drupal. You should be able to see from the above example that the treeview control works very well for showing the file system, like in windows explorer, the fullpath property gives us everything we need to tell where the file is located.

Add a treeview control named treeview1 to the form, and position it on the left side of the splitcontainer control. Treeview properties of treeview control in visual basic 6. I may be slightly biased, but i think its an awesome tool for building functional windows interfaces. Users can look at information, or objects, presented in a treeview control and quickly determine how those objects are bound together figure 4.

Treeview 64 bit download x 64bit download x64bit download freeware, shareware and software downloads. Explorer treeview control with shell folder access class and icon. For instance, figure 1 shows that the progid for the treeview control is mscomctllib. Multiselect in vb6 treeview control solutions experts exchange. The vb6 treeview control raises a click event also if you click on the controls blank area, whereas the. Hi, is there a set of detailed help files for microsoft treeview control 6. These downloads were all provided by microsoft for vb5 andor vb6, and the links will point to download.

Right now i have the following code that works when i have it setting a control, but not a control from a variable. However, we are releasing this nonsecurity related package because it contains improvements that were ready for release just prior to the end of mainstream support. Included in the free download is the full, commented source code for all examples that you can see in the demos page the easiest way to use treeview is to choose the demo that most closely matches your needs, and. In this tip, irina medvinskaya presents an example that uses the treeview. When the control is used in an application as opposed to a web page and run in windows with at least ie4 installed, internet urls do not appear in the treeview under the internet explorer shell folder. Dec 31, 20 vb6 how to disable tree view checkboxes in nodes. As with any other control, msdn contains all the methods, properties and even samples for it. Additionally crashes have been fixed in explorerlistview, explorertreeview and shellbrowsercontrols, and a memory leak has been fixed in.

I am trying to implement drag and drop with my treeview control. Lets click on a treeview control from the toolbox and place it on the form. Nov 05, 2015 the treeview and listview controls are commonly used along with the image list control. This control allows you to add nodes to a tree, each of which can have sub items. The foldertreeview control is extremely complex requiring over two years of research, development and testing. Treeview the following example dynamically adds two intrinsic and one activex control to an application at runtime. For those who remember the common controls ocxs featured in visual basic 5 and 6, there was one peculiarity of. Before we get into the details of the treeview and listview controls, a quick overview of the imagelist control is in order.

Vba help reference files for microsoft treeview control 6. Net examples used for treeview control example for vb. It provides no added functionality aside from the standard treeview control methods, properties, and events, however it does provide a shellitem class, which can be used to extend this basic example for your own needs, and it is. To start with select microsoft windows common controls 6. This is an article addressing some of the basics of working with a treeview control. It provides no added functionality aside from the standard treeview control methods, properties, and events, however it does provide a shellitem class, which can be used to extend this basic example for your own needs, and it is also a. Treeview control treeview control is used to display hierarchical tree like information such as a directory hierarchy. To get icons into the menus, just link the icon menu control to an image list and then tell it which icons to use with which menu items.

Users can look at information, or objects, presented in a treeview control and quickly determine how those objects are bound together. Net project help lets start our discussion with a few simple properties that you can see that design time through the control s property pages. Parts of the code are based on other codeproject tutorials and. Net treeview control raises the click event only if you click on a node. Treeview checkbox software free download treeview checkbox top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. I have used a treeview control in vb6, where each node has a checkbox and i want some code so that users can select multiple nodes simply by selecting them as we select in a listbox. Dynamically add controls to a form with visual basic 6.

I suggest that you download the demo from that article and run the demo form select your phone and try to access the files showing in the listview by. Children returns the total number of child nodes for a given node. In the list of templates, choose windows forms application. This sample will demonstrate the basic usage of the treeview control. Methods of the treeview control the following are some of the commonly used methods of the treeview control. If your internet connection is less than 300k, it is recommended that you run the multipart download by following the more information link at the upper right, then clicking download now. Add a listview control named listview1 to the form, and position it on the right side of the. Tia if this answer solves your problem, please check, mark as answered. The purpose of a treeview control is to display information in a hierarchy. Application works as expected on standard windows 7 and windows 8 pcs. You can also use the following additional properties to control the behavior and appearance of the treeview. Browse other questions tagged vb6 treeview or ask your own question.

Oct 21, 2002 he treeview control is one of the most flexible windows controls. The listview looks similar to the treeview control in that items can be grouped note that items need to be added when a listitem is expanded and removed when contracted by. The problem is, when i click on a node, drag it, and drop it to other node. Net windows forms project, and design your form to resemble the next figure. Internet urls do not appear in the treeview under the internet explorer shell folder. Progress kb progress client crashes when trying to. You can use many of these properties to navigate through a treeview, as follows. Selecteditem returns a reference to the node currently selected in the treeview control. The tree view control is a visual basic version of the control you see used in many programs, including explorer and frontpage, used to list the folders on your hard disk.

The sample shows how to program the events of a dynamically added control. Crash can be reproduced using the same activex in a microsoft excel spreadsheet macro or a visual basic 6. The freevbcode site provides free visual basic code, examples, snippets, and articles on a variety of other topics as well. While paup and macclade have excellent tree printing facilities, there may be times you just want to view the trees without having to load the data set they. I am trying to setup a treeview object, set the nodes, and then update a control to have the values appropriately formatted. You will find lots of vb source code, tutorials and some superb custom controls.

This article shows how to dynamically add intrinsic and activex controls. Vb6 provides the dirlist and filelist controls, but vb. This excellent code sample shows how to make a listview control similar to those used in outlook and outlook express. Mar 25, 2004 before starting the download, create a download directory on your computer. Enabling shell styles for the listview and treeview. I have tried to correct the code according to your suggestion, and now i get the top level and the top department. These powerful shell controls including tree view, list view and combo box allow you to build simple or complex filefolder.

But when the control is run from a web page, or in an application with the webbrowser control, the urls do appear when the internet. This activex control was written in vb6 and is meant as an alternative to the treeview control which comes with vb. Treeeview is typically used to display the headings in a document, the entries in an index, the files and directories on a disk, or any other kind of information that might usefully be displayed as a hierarchy. This code is translated from vb6, and i did not find any reason for converting to the net. Whenever you need to display hierarchical data in a treelike format in vb. It displays hierarchical data and lets users navigate through the hierarchy by expanding and collapsing nodes at will. The treeview and listview controls visual basic assignment. This example shows how to load a treeview from a text file with tabs denoting indentation in visual basic. Treeview provides a simple way to view the contents of a nexus treeview provides a simple way to view the contents of a nexus, phylip, hennig86, clustal, or other format tree file. Load a treeview control from a file that uses tabs to show indentation. Add, remove and edit items to this tree view, fast and easy. Ado and yes i am a bit wonky with this treeview control.

Add a windowsexplorerlike folder browser control to your app. Net the source code and files included in this project are listed in the project files section, please make sure whether the listed source code meet your needs there. Using the treeview control visual basic assignment help. Net is a full featured crossbrowser treeview control. Displaying shell elements in a treeview vbaccelerator. Hannes du preez shows you how easy it is to create a treeview in vb.

This article demonstrates a very simple way to populate a treeview with files and or folders using the shell automation object provided in. Foldertreeview, vb6 common controls replacement project. But when the control is run from a web page, or in an application with. Treeview vb6, free treeview vb6 software downloads. Give your applications windows explorer features with the shell control pack activex. The treeview and listview controls are commonly used along with the image list control. Treeview checkbox software free download treeview checkbox.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. The imagelist control is a very simple control or storing images, so they can be retrieved quickly arid used at runtime. Shell control pack activex plasmatech software design. This is the snippet fully dynamic treeview menu on freevbcode. Shell megapack is a set of ui controls which gives dropin windows explorerlike shell browsing functionality to your applications. Net explorer tree control with imagelist management.

This sample code displays employee name in the treeview control from the emp table of scott schema in oracle database. On december 31, 20 december 31, 20 by matteo72 in visual basic 6 the mscomctllib treeview control has a property to show checkboxes for each nodes. Icons in menus v2 the icon menu control makes it simple. It also makes the treeview send messages to its container the form when a node is expanded or collapsed. It is always best to learn practically that is how i have learned. Numerous properties for the treeview control and for node objects define the appearance of the tree and give access to nodes within the tree. In the properties window for treeview1 do the following. Download vb6 treeview source codes, vb6 treeview scripts. Jul 15, 2001 the tree view control is a visual basic version of the control you see used in many programs, including explorer and frontpage, used to list the folders on your hard disk. Before evaluating this i had downloaded dozen of other controls. Combine with fileview and shcombobox to recreate an entire windows explorer shell browsing gui right inside your own forms. How to create a treeview file browser component in vb. Nodes returns a reference to the entire nodes collection for the treeview.

Using the treeview control visual basic assignment help, vb. Controls from shell megapack being used in various ides. The treeview control is used to display hierarchical representations of items similar to the ways the files and folders are displayed in the left pane of the windows explorer. The top level in a tree view are root nodes that can be expanded or. Multiselect in vb6 treeview control solutions experts. The application fails only on machines with the touchscreen capability. Search files in a directory hierarchy for a target string in visual basic. Article which describes how to display listview and treeview controls using visual styles in windows vista or higher via the setwindowtheme api. Treeview control is used to display hierarchical tree like information such as a directory hierarchy download source code.

393 431 490 247 34 112 1297 1089 1020 1396 1666 1072 1254 186 1003 1153 1379 644 1074 945 779 1090 1287 1446 210 1366 411 578 1102 26 821 167 925 1246